Akron City Council has approved the establishment of a new cannabis dispensary by Terrasana at 235 E. Waterloo Road, the former location of Steinly’s Restaurant. The council voted unanimously on May 19, allowing Terrasana to operate both a medical and adult-use dispensary at this site.
Steinly’s Restaurant, a local favorite, closed its doors in late 2023 after years of serving the Firestone Park community. The property has a rich history, having housed various drive-in restaurants since the mid-1950s, including the Beverly Park Drive-In, which opened in 1956. Over the decades, it changed hands and names several times before Steinly’s took over in 1992.
Terrasana, an Ohio-based cannabis business, currently operates five dispensaries across the state, with locations in Garfield Heights, Grandview, Fremont, Middletown, and Springfield. The company also plans to open a new store in Canton, which is in close proximity to Akron. According to their website, Terrasana holds licenses from the Ohio Division of Cannabis Control to cultivate and process cannabis in Columbus under the names CannaMed Therapeutics LLC and CannaMed Therapeutics Processing, LLC.
Craig Maurer, co-founder of Terrasana, expressed enthusiasm about becoming a part of the Akron community during a public hearing with the city council. He noted that many of the company’s owners have ties to Ohio, with personal connections to the region. Terrasana has received a provisional state license for the new dispensary in Akron and is working towards launching additional stores in Canton and Zanesville.
Despite recent regulatory changes in Akron, including a six-month moratorium on new smoke and vape shops, this does not impact the operation of regulated cannabis dispensaries like Terrasana. The council’s ordinance, passed on May 5, specifically targets smoke and vape establishments due to concerns about unregulated operations and compliance issues. City officials aim to address regulatory gaps that have allowed some shops to operate without proper licensing.
The establishment of Terrasana’s dispensary marks a shift in the building’s use, moving from a traditional dining establishment to a center for cannabis commerce. The new business is expected to contribute to the local economy and provide residents with access to both medical and recreational cannabis products.
